1 // Copyright (c) 2012 The Chromium Authors. All rights reserved. 2 // Use of this source code is governed by a BSD-style license that can be 3 // found in the LICENSE file. 4 5 #ifndef CHROME_BROWSER_UI_ASH_ASH_UTIL_H_ 6 #define CHROME_BROWSER_UI_ASH_ASH_UTIL_H_ 7 8 #include "ui/gfx/native_widget_types.h" 9 10 namespace chrome { 11 12 // Returns true if |native_view/native_window| exists within the Ash 13 // environment. 14 bool IsNativeViewInAsh(gfx::NativeView native_view); 15 bool IsNativeWindowInAsh(gfx::NativeWindow native_window); 16 17 // Opens the Ash desktop if it's closed; otherwise, closes it. 18 void ToggleAshDesktop(); 19 20 } // namespace chrome 21 22 #endif // CHROME_BROWSER_UI_ASH_ASH_UTIL_H_ 23